About Longwood Park

Longwood Park is located on John H. Kerr Reservoir, a 50,000-acre lake that extends 39 miles up the wooded, cove-studded shoreline of the Roanoke River in Virginia and North Carolina. Kerr Reservoir, also known as Buggs Island Lake, was created with the construction of the John H. Kerr Dam in 1952. Its 800 miles of wooded shoreline stretch across six counties and two states and offer countless recreation opportunities for visitors.

Highway access

Longwood Park is accessible via Highway 15, which runs through Clarksville, VA. The nearest major road is U.S. Route 58, approximately 10 miles south, providing connections to other regional highways.
